利用SnifferPro深度解析网络抓包与协议分析
5星 · 超过95%的资源 需积分: 43 113 浏览量
更新于2024-11-26
4
收藏 244KB DOC 举报
本实验旨在通过计算机网络抓包,让学生深入理解网络协议的工作原理和网络分层思想。实验主要使用SnifferPro软件,这是一款强大的网络分析工具,用于捕获和分析网络流量。以下是实验的关键组成部分:
1. 实验目的:
- 学生将通过实际操作,从感性层面理解网络分层,特别是数据链路层、网络层和传输层的结构。
- 重点理解ARP(地址解析协议)在局域网中的作用,以及它如何将MAC地址与IP地址关联起来。
- 深入剖析TCP(传输控制协议),它是互联网通信的基础,确保数据传输的可靠性,如HTTP、FTP等服务的运行依赖于TCP。
- UDP(用户数据报协议)作为另一种常用协议,尽管不提供可靠连接,但因其轻量级特性,在SNMP、TFTP和DNS等场景中扮演重要角色。
2. 实验内容和要求:
- 必做部分:捕获数据包,分析其不同层次的格式,增强网络分层概念的认识。
- 可选部分:深入研究ARP协议的工作原理,TCP的可靠传输机制,以及UDP的快速传输特点。
- 实验过程中,学生需熟练运用SnifferPro软件,通过设置过滤器捕获特定协议的数据包,进一步理解协议的实现细节。
3. 实验设备与材料:
- 每位学生需准备一台联网的计算机,安装SnifferPro V4.7.530软件。
- 参考文献和附录提供了软件安装和使用方法的指导。
4. 实验方法与步骤:
- 安装SnifferPro:按照参考文献或附录中的指导完成软件安装。
- 开始捕获:启动程序后,选择捕获功能开始监听网络流量,可以通过菜单选项、快捷键F10或工具栏按钮操作。
通过这个综合性的实验,学生将不仅掌握基本的网络抓包技术,还能对关键协议的底层工作原理有更深入的理解,这对于从事网络工程或相关领域的工作具有重要的实践价值。同时,实验也鼓励独立思考,提出自己的疑问和见解,有助于提升问题解决能力。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2013-04-26 上传
点击了解资源详情
102 浏览量
2021-12-16 上传
2021-10-02 上传
windufly
- 粉丝: 5
- 资源: 1
最新资源
- SCA-Algorithms:拉德布德大学TUe硕士论文中使用的SCA算法
- gh_trend:GitHub上的Dart和Flutter搜寻器趋势
- bookstore_网上商城_dog8fp_failed4dm_
- datastudio-2-slack
- 基于CSS3实现六种不同动画效果星级评分特效源码.zip
- Smart-home--Linux.zip_嵌入式Linux_Visual_C++_
- how-not-to-be-a-shame:如何成为一名优秀的开发者
- Lucene-Search-Engine-on-Covid19-articles-
- HTML网站源码-社会化媒体按钮网页模板.zip
- Android 蓝牙配对、协议栈使能、inquiry、discovery、hci发送数据、等等详细源码流程图,非常详细的从bti
- 易语言提取ICO图标源码-易语言
- autonomous-data:一种开放标准,用于构建尊重数据所有权的应用程序
- js_罗马盘_js_
- plugin.video.telkkarista:KODI的Telkkarista
- 基于bootstrap实现的jQuery日期范围选择插件特效源码.zip
- tinman-art.github.io